FRONT FORK
NOTE:
_
• When assembling the front fork leg, be sure
to replace the following parts:
- inner tube bushing
- outer tube bushing
- oil seal
- dust seal
- cap bolt O-ring
• Before assembling the front fork leg, make
sure all of the components are clean.
1. Install:
• damper rod 1
• rebound spring 2
CAUTION:
_
Allow the damper rod to slide slowly down
the inner tube 3 until it protrudes from the
bottom of the inner tube. Be careful not to
damage the inner tube.
2. Lubricate:
• inner tube's outer surface
Recommended lubricant
Yamaha fork oil 10 WT
3. Tighten:
• copper washer
• damper rod bolt 1
Damper rod bolt
30 Nm (3.0 m · kg, 22 ft · lb)
LOCTITE
NOTE:
_
While holding the damper rod assembly with
the damper rod holder 2 and T-handle 3,
tighten the damper rod bolt.
Damper rod holder
90890-01460
T-handle
90890-01326
